Each tool targets a distinct aspect of Snowflake cost and performance: queries (expensive vs detail), warehouses (credit usage, sizing recommendations, listing), and a fallback for arbitrary queries. No overlap in purpose.
All tool names follow a consistent verb_noun pattern using snake_case (find_expensive_queries, get_query_detail, list_warehouses, etc.). Predictable and readable.
With 6 tools, the surface is well-scoped for Snowflake cost management—covering query and warehouse analysis without bloat. Each tool earns its place.
Covers core cost investigation (expensive queries, warehouse usage, sizing) and includes a generic run tool for gaps. Missing finer breakdowns (e.g., by user/database) but no critical dead ends.
